For a [[guild]] on {{questchain|The Scepter of the Shifting Sands}} quest chain, this fight should not be a challenge and can be done with as few as 15 members. Maws is a straightforward boss fight in the waters of Azshara. There is no need to submerge during this encounter, so [[Water Breathing]] is not necessary. Maws will hit the [[MT]] pretty hard and somewhat sporadically so you need a fair amount of healers on him. Maws will [[frenzy]], so it is important that your [[hunter]]s use a [[Tranquilizing Shot]] when this occurs. Maws enrages every 25 seconds, and every 15 seconds when his health reaches 20%. When Maws is below 20%, he will occasionally [[AoE]] for 2000-3000 damage every 15 seconds. [[Prayer of Healing]] should be able to keep all raid members up due to the long interval between AoE ticks. Make sure the [[druid]]s and [[paladin]]s/[[shaman]]s step up the healing on the MT while the [[priest]]s are group healing.
